DAKOTA WESLEYAN UNIVERSITY<br />
<strong>12</strong>00 W. University Ave., Mitchell, SD 57301 • 1-800-333-8506<br />
admissions@dwu.edu • www.dwu.edu<br />
• <strong>DWU</strong> is a private liberal arts university. It was founded in 1885.<br />
• The financial aid priority deadline is April 1.<br />
• The majority of our students come from the Midwest, but we also have students<br />
from across the nation and around the world. <strong>DWU</strong> is one of the most diverse<br />
campuses in South Dakota.<br />
• A higher connection – <strong>DWU</strong> is proudly affiliated with the Dakotas Conference of<br />
the United Methodist Church. Members of any and all faiths are welcome and<br />
encouraged to experience an education based on learning, leadership, faith and<br />
service.<br />
<strong>Athletics</strong><br />
National Association of Intercollegiate<br />
<strong>Athletics</strong> (NAIA), Great Plains Athletic<br />
Conference (GPAC)<br />
Sports: baseball, basketball, cross<br />
country, football, golf, soccer, softball,<br />
track and field, volleyball, wrestling<br />

Mitchell<br />
a great college town<br />
www.cityofmitchell.org<br />
Mitchell, S.D., offers a unique college atmosphere to students<br />
who attend Dakota Wesleyan University. The continually growing<br />
city of roughly 15,000 people packages the feel of a close-knit<br />
community into a city with endless resources for shopping,<br />
entertainment and recreation.<br />
Expanding commercial districts on the north and south ends<br />
of town combine with Mitchell’s historic Main Street to provide<br />
ample opportunities for shopping, dining, hotels and night life, as<br />
well as job opportunities that value students’ talents and abilities.<br />
Sioux Falls, just a 60-minute drive east on I-90, offers even more<br />
big-city amenities to students and their families.<br />
The city has both a state-of-the-art movie theatre and a drive-in<br />
open during the warm-weather months, along with endless<br />
opportunities for outdoor recreation. Mitchell is home to two 18-<br />
hole golf courses, indoor and outdoor swimming pool facilities,<br />
tennis courts, athletic fields, a hockey arena and numerous<br />
recreation and fitness centers. Lake Mitchell provides boating,<br />
swimming, fishing and camping opportunities, and the<br />
surrounding area is well-known for its world-class pheasant<br />
hunting.<br />
Mitchell is known for the World’s Only Corn Palace, but this<br />
South Dakota community has plenty to offer its college<br />
students.<br />
Mitchell is a safe, comfortable community that feels like home.<br />
